Freezingmyarseoff · 12/03/2015 20:01

Depends on whether it is caused by a virus or bacterium. If viral I think there is no treatment but antibiotics are prescribed for a bacterial infection. Typically, but not always, a bacterial infection causes pus/white spots on the tonsils.
